In this video, I show you how to create a DIY biltong chopper using scrap wood. If you're a fan of South African-style cured meat, you'll know how important it is to have the right tools to slice and chop your tough biltong strips. This project is made out of handy pieces of scrap Tasmanian Oak and Spotted Gum with a repurposed plane iron for cutting and a simple mineral oil finish. I'll take you through my process of creating the chopper, assembling the final product, and using it on some biltong.
